Financing A Car With Bad Credit Can Be A Challenge But It Can Be Accomplished

The way to get a lower rate is by improving your credit score. This may take some time but its well worth the effort. Nearly everyone who lives where a car can be easily driven also wants to own a car. This high demand for car ownership has made both cars popular and easier to finance.

There are still some issues surrounding Bad Credit Car Loans. Some years ago bad credit car finance was almost nonexistent. Then a few years ago, financing a car with bad credit became easier, almost too easy. Now in the past two years, bad credit car finance has gotten somewhat more difficult. Really it is now gotten back to basics instead of "no problem at all".

You can still get car loans for bad credit but now you need to do your homework and follow the rules and procedures. It starts with your credit score. If you have poor credit, start now being careful and try to start working toward a good score. A good credit score is the key to getting a car loan at a good interest rate.

You can check your credit score annually for no charge by asking any of the credit bureaus to send you your credit score. Once you know it, you ...
... have the place to start. The first thing to do is to start searching on the internet. There are many bad credit car loans offered on the web. These companies specialize in car loans for people with bad credit or no credit and they will often lend money when more traditional lenders will not. If you discover that you have really bad credit or no credit and you want a car now, there are several other things you can do.

One is to put up a down payment or use some property you have as collateral. This shows the lender you are serious. Another alternative is to get a co-signer, one who has good credit. This can be a relative or a friend. Someone who knows you is often no afraid to cosign for you. Every lender has their rules and procedures and you may be surprised how many are willing to work with you.

Some may want to charge an application fee and you should resist this if you have any alternative. Some may not require a down payment but will charge a really high interest rate. In this case study both options. If you are buying a car that's not too expensive, then it may be to your benefit to pay the higher interest and keep your cash available that you were going to pay the down payment. As you improve your credit score, you can always trade in the current car and get another car with a more favorable loan.

As a general rule, most car sellers whether a dealer or a private party, the primary determinate regarding interest rate is your credit score. This makes the first step and most important step getting up your score. This may take a little time. In the mean time get a car you can afford even with a high interest rate. If you are lucky enough to make a down payment or get a co-signer, this is something you do not want to face every time you go to buy a car. It all comes back to getting your credit score moved up and that's up to you. Nowadays financing a car with bad credit will probably not be as hard as you expect. The internet has made bad credit car loans accessible to most bad credit borrowers. Just face up to this and work on being a "good credit" buyer the next time.
